Output 86545e2c4fb623cf259749f70f584356cea0000b2c30af473f103e02e6864359:1

value
625157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ff926608a6c34770889f6dcc33f2e488b3a91a86 OP_EQUAL
address
3QzMcQpMqahjLgZZNsjPwRax2rhGQ6aUhj
transaction
86545e2c4fb623cf259749f70f584356cea0000b2c30af473f103e02e6864359
confirmations
148180
spent
true